Pharmacokinetics of Acetaminophen in Morbidly Obese Patients

Brief summary

This study will investigate the pharmacokinetics of acetaminophen in morbidly obese patients versus normal weight patients. Specifically the different metabolic pathways of acetaminophen in morbidly obese adults will be investigated; glucuronidation, sulphation and CYP2E1 (cytochrome P450 2E1) oxidation

Inclusion criteria

for morbidly obese patients: * BMI \> 40 kg/m2 undergoing bariatric surgery. * Patients between 18 - 60 years old * ASA physical classification of II or III * All racial and ethnic groups will be included Inclusion criteria for control group: * BMI between 18 and 25 kg/m2 undergoing general surgery * Patients between 18 - 60 years old * ASA (American Society of Anesthesiology) physical classification of I, II or III * All racial and ethnic groups will be included

Exclusion criteria

for all study arms: * Renal insufficiency * Liver disease * Patients with Gilbert-Meulengracht syndrome * Chronic alcohol intake or use of alcohol within last 72 hours * Pregnancy or breastfeeding * Patients who are treated with drugs know to affect CYP2E1 and UGT (UDP glucuronosyltransferase) * Diabetes mellitus type II patients * Smoking * Acetaminophen intake before the study (24 hours before study)

Design outcomes

Primary

MeasureTime frame
Clearance (total, glucuronidation, sulphation, CYP2E1 oxidation and unchanged) of acetaminophen in morbidly obese patients in comparison with normal weight patients.24 hours
Volume of distribution of acetaminophen in morbidly obese patients in comparison with normal weight patients.24 hours

Secondary

MeasureTime frame
Difference in clearance (total, glucuronidation, sulphation, CYP2E1 oxidation) of acetaminophen in morbidly obese patients at the time of bariatric surgery and at 0.5 - 2 year after bariatric surgery.8 hours
Difference in volume of distribution of acetaminophen in morbidly obese patients at the time of bariatric surgery and at 0.5 - 2 year after bariatric surgery.8 hours
Liver function tests in morbidly obese patients in comparison with normal weight patients.24 hours
